Virginia to Take Down Robert E. Lee Statue on Wednesday
A statue of Confederate Civil War General Robert E. Lee that towers six stories over Richmond, Virginia, is coming down this week. The Commonwealth of Virginia announced on Sunday it would remove the 12-ton bronze statue on Monument Avenue on Wednesday, stashing it in a secure state-owned storage site until a decision on its future…
